PANE



Name: Ken Wincrest
Age: 15
Hometown: Pyrite Town, Orre

Appearance
Ken is average height for his age, standing at about 5”9. He has a slender build, with muscle only just beginning to appear visibly on his arms and legs. All of the time spent in the Orre desert has lightly tanned his skin. His hair is a soft blond color, which is typically kept short and spiky along the bangs. Below this, his eyes are a cold, dark blue that fails to display information well.

Typically, Ken will be seen wearing a soft orange t-shirt that has sleeves that only go half-way down his biceps. Over this, he wears a black vest that hold several tube-like pockets in a pattern of three going down on each breast of the vest. His pants are generally green cargo pants, with large pockets on each leg for more supplies. His belt is orange in color, and has been formatted to easily house six pokeballs on his left side and a holster for his Pokegear on the right. Depending on the weather, he may or may not be wearing a pair of dark sunglasses to shield his eyes from the elements.

Personality
Ken is a very determined individual. This is his driving force for wanting to become powerful. His determination has the unfortunate tendency to be misinterpreted as cruelty. He tends to expect much from his Pokémon, and is less than forgiving when they fail. He has a similar view on people, and views those who take a carefree attitude to Pokémon training with disdain. Victory is the only thing that matters, and anything less than that means that he has failed. As such, Ken isn’t quick to solve his problems through fighting, and will rarely fight anybody he deems beneath himself unless necessary. During battle, he is cold and calculating, and will pull no punches in order to obtain victory.

Biography
Pyrite Town was a seedy town. The criminals ran rampant, and the police had quit trying to stop them long ago. It was no place to raise a child, but that didn’t stop the Wincrest couple from trying. They raised their son as best they could, but as he grew older he kept getting into trouble. Be it fights with thugs or pick-pocketing travelers, Ken kept falling deeper and deeper into the corruption of the city. The only solution was to send him to live with his grandparents in Johto.

Upon his arrival in Mahogany Town, Ken was quickly taken under the wing of his grandfather, who had been a prominent member of the police force. His grandfather reasoned that all that the boy needed was strict discipline, so he gave it to him in spades. This treatment whipped him into shape that by his thirteenth birthday, Ken was awarded with his first Pokémon: a Swinub. This would be his grandfather’s first and only sign of kindness, as he died only a few months later. At the funeral Ken watched on emotionless, as it would have been a sign of weakness to cry.

Unable to support a growing boy, Ken’s grandmother sent him back to his parents. The boy returned changed. The mischievous scamp was no more, and he quickly formed enemies with the local criminals. Their errand boy had abandoned them and now had the nerve to show his face in town again. One day, a group of them attempted to gang up on him and beat him up, only to be easily dispatched by him and his Pokémon. This trend continued for the next couple of years, until Ken finally grew bored of the destruction of the weak. He ventured out into the desert alone to hopefully find a challenge. He found sand. After much searching, he saw it. A lone Hippopotas was digging its way around an oasis. This was the challenge he needed, another Pokémon. After a long and hardy battle, Ken realized two things: one, was that he needed more challenging opponents to show off against, and two, he would need more Pokémon to do so. So he caught the Hippopotas and immediately went home.

Without the simplest of goodbyes to his parents, he packed his bags and hitched a ride to Gateon Port. There he boarded a ship bound for Furoh. He had heard this was where those with strength met, and he was the strongest of all. All he needed to do was find the chance to prove it.
